Revision of the metallic species of Lasioglossum (Dialictus) in Canada (Hymenoptera, Halictidae, Halictini)

The bee subgenus Dialictus (Hymenoptera: Halictidae: Lasioglossum) comprises the most commonly collected bees in North America and have the most diverse social systems of any equivalent group of insects. Despite their importance, as pollinators and as model organisms for studying the evolution of social behaviour, Dialictus remain one of the greatest challenges in bee taxonomy. A taxonomic revision of the metallic species of Canadian Dialictus has been completed which resolves many of the difficulties of these bees. Complete species descriptions with illustrations are provided for 84 metallic Dialictus in Canada along with keys to identify males and females. Eleven subgeneric names recently proposed by Pesenko are treated as synonymies of Dialictus. Some species names are used here in a sense different from those of most previous authors (e.g. H. nymphaearus, H. versatus). Names have often been misapplied in past usage sometimes subsuming multiple species. In some cases, even paratypes do not correspond to the same species as the name bearing type.
